Output 1f5ffe5781b29ef76fca3682494d6bae8a6dc0fc7eaea43ecf20be4bdbbb5296:2

value
173996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4ea577a75bd2a2dcfe135a28a7289a69bb7bfc OP_EQUAL
address
3EPc4epVfziLuwi4hU81djk95tJVoYRQzX
transaction
1f5ffe5781b29ef76fca3682494d6bae8a6dc0fc7eaea43ecf20be4bdbbb5296
spent
true